THE COMPANY

 

C.The Company is an exempted company which was incorporated with limited liability under the laws of the Cayman Islands on 18 May 2010 with company number 240791 and registered in Hong Kong as an overseas company on 18 August 2010 under Part XI of the Companies Ordinance with company number F0017770. The Company’s registered office address is currently situated at PwC Corporate Finance and Recovery (Cayman) Limited, P.O. Box 258, 18 Forum Lane, Camana Bay, Grand Cayman KY1-1104, Cayman Islands.

 

D.The shares of the Company were listed on the main board of HKEx (Stock Code: 975) on 13 October 2010. As at 17 February 2017, the authorised share capital of the Company was US$150,000,000 divided into 15,000,000,000 ordinary shares of a nominal or par value of US$0.01 each, of which 9,263,000,000.00 of the 15,000,000,000 ordinary shares were issued and fully paid.

 

THE PURPOSE OF THE SCHEME

 

E.The Restructuring comprises of a restructuring of the Company's existing indebtedness under:

 

30 

 

a.the Old Notes pursuant to the Schemes and the Notes Restructuring Documents;

 

b.the Senior Secured Facilities Agreement pursuant to the Senior Secured Facilities Restructuring; and

 

c.the Promissory Notes pursuant to the Promissory Notes Restructuring.

 

F.The Restructuring has been promulgated by the Company, acting by and under the authority of the Joint Provisional Liquidators, and includes various measures which are intended to ensure that the Company and the Group can continue to operate on a going concern basis.

 

G.The purpose of the Scheme is to effect a compromise and arrangement between the Company and the Scheme Creditors so as to implement a financial restructuring of the Liabilities of the Company and the Old Notes Subsidiary Guarantors under and/or in connection with the Old Notes and the Old Notes Documents. The effectiveness of this Cayman Scheme is conditional upon the effectiveness of the Senior Secured Facilities Restructuring and the Promissory Notes Restructuring and the Schemes are conditional upon the effectiveness of each other. In summary, this Cayman Scheme provides for the release of all of the Scheme Claims of the Scheme Creditors in consideration for which the Participating Scheme Creditors will be entitled to receive in full and final settlement a distribution on a pro rata basis of the following Scheme Consideration:

 

i.a portion of the Term Sheet New Notes;

 

ii.a portion of the New Perpetual Notes; and

 

iii.a portion of the New Shares.

 

OLD NOTES ISSUED BY THE COMPANY

 

H.The Old Notes were issued by the Company pursuant to the terms of the Old Notes Indenture and are held under an arrangement whereby:

 

i.the Old Notes have been issued in global registered form with Global Notes, initially being deposited with and registered in the name of the Old Notes Depository (or its nominee, Cede & Co.), through the Old Notes Depository

 

31 

 

under electronic systems designed to facilitate paperless transactions of dematerialised securities; and

 

ii.such electronic systems designed to facilitate paperless transactions involve interests in the Old Notes being held by Account Holders. Each Account Holder may be holding its interests in the Old Notes on behalf of itself and/or (directly or indirectly) one or more Scheme Creditors.

 

THE OLD NOTES AND THIS CAYMAN SCHEME

 

I.The Old Notes will remain in global form for the purposes of this Cayman Scheme. The Old Notes Depository in its capacity as depository for the Old Notes and on behalf of its nominee (Cede & Co.) as registered holder of the Old Notes, has confirmed that it does not intend to vote in respect of the Old Notes at the Scheme Meetings. The Old Notes Trustee is not a Scheme Creditor and will not vote at the Scheme Meetings.

 

J.References in this Cayman Scheme to Scheme Creditors shall in relation to the Old Notes be references to persons with a beneficial interest as principal in the Old Notes held in global form or global restricted form through the Clearing Systems at the Record Time and who have a right, upon satisfaction of certain conditions, to be issued definitive notes in accordance with the terms of the Old Notes and the Old Notes Indenture at the Record Time. References to Old Notes "held" by a Scheme Creditor shall be construed accordingly.

 

K.Each Scheme Creditor shall be entitled to vote at the Scheme Meetings in respect of each of the Old Notes held by it.

PART B

 

The CAYMAN Scheme

 

1Application and Effectiveness of this Cayman Scheme

 

1.1The compromise and arrangement effected by this Cayman Scheme shall apply to all Scheme Claims and shall be binding on the Company and all Scheme Creditors (and any person who acquires any interest in or arising out of a Scheme Claim after the Record Time). The Scheme Creditors shall be eligible to receive certain rights in accordance with the terms of this Cayman Scheme in full and final settlement of all Scheme Claims.

 

1.2Save as otherwise indicated, this Cayman Scheme shall become effective in accordance with its terms on the Scheme Effective Date.

 

1.3If the Restructuring Effective Date has not occurred on or before the Scheme Longstop Date, the terms of, and obligations on the parties under or pursuant to, this Cayman Scheme shall lapse and all compromises and arrangements provided by this Cayman Scheme shall have no force or effect.

 

1.4On and following the Restructuring Effective Date, the Scheme Claims of each Scheme Creditor (and any person who acquires any interest in or arising out of a Scheme Claim after the Record Time) shall be subject to the compromises and arrangements set out in this Cayman Scheme.

 

2Effect of this Cayman Scheme

 

2.1On and following the Restructuring Effective Date:

 

2.1.1all of the right, title and interest of the Scheme Creditors (and any person who acquires any interest in or arising out of a Scheme Claim after the Record Time) to the Scheme Claims shall be subject to the arrangements set out in Clause 3;

 

2.1.2the Scheme Creditors shall, subject to becoming Participating Scheme Creditors, become entitled to the Scheme Consideration in accordance with the terms of this Cayman Scheme and the Distribution Agreement; and

 

2.1.3the Company and certain other parties shall be released in accordance with the terms of this Cayman Scheme.

 

34 

 

3Compromise and Arrangement with the Scheme Creditors

 

3.1On and following the Restructuring Effective Date, notwithstanding any term of any relevant documents and subject to the terms of this Cayman Scheme, the Scheme Claims shall be released and discharged fully and absolutely, all liens or other security interests held for the benefit of any Scheme Creditor against the property of the Company and the Old Notes Subsidiary Guarantors shall be fully released and discharged and any documents giving rise to a Scheme Claim shall be deemed cancelled and surrendered, in each case so as to bind the Scheme Creditors (and any person who acquires any interest in or arising out of a Scheme Claim after the Record Time) in consideration for which the Company or Energy Resources, as applicable, shall issue the Scheme Consideration to the Participating Scheme Creditors and their Designated Recipients (if any) subject to Clause 15 and the terms of Part D below.

 

3.2For the avoidance of doubt, Non-Participating Scheme Creditors shall have no right or entitlement to receive any Scheme Consideration.

PART D

 

distribution of sCheme consideration
TO SCHEME CREDITORS

 

11Term Sheet New Notes

 

11.1On the Initial Distribution Date, Energy Resources shall issue the Term Sheet New Notes in accordance with the terms of this Cayman Scheme, the New Notes Indenture and the Distribution Agreement.

 

11.2Each Participating Scheme Creditor shall be entitled to receive a share of the Term Sheet New Notes calculated in accordance with the following formula, such that each Participating Scheme Creditor will be entitled to receive (rounded down to the nearest US$1.00 and subject to a minimum denomination of US$1,000):

 


A

 

Aggregate principal amount of the Term Sheet New Notes

 

x

 


B

=

 

Term Sheet New Notes entitlement

 


X + (Y- Z)

 

 

 

 

 

A = Principal amount of Term Sheet New Notes to be issued (US$395,000,000  plus the principal amount of Term Sheet PIK Notes in relation to the first coupon payment deemed to have occurred on 1 April 2017 pursuant to the New Notes Indenture)

 
 
B =  Total amount of all principal and interest outstanding in respect of the Old Notes held by a Participating Scheme Creditor as at the Record Time, plus interest accrued between the Record Time and the Initial Distribution Date  on any such Old Notes.

     

 

47 

 

X = Total amount of all principal and interest outstanding in respect of the Old Notes as at the Initial Distribution Date.
 
 
Y = Total amount  of all principal and interest outstanding in respect of the Senior Secured Facilities Agreement as at the Initial Distribution Date.
 
 
Z = US$30,000,000


 

 

 

11.3On the Initial Distribution Date, Energy Resources shall issue the New Notes in global registered form in the name of the New Notes Depository or its nominee.

 

11.4On the Initial Distribution Date, the portion of the Term Sheet New Notes which forms Scheme Consideration will be allocated to the relevant accounts in the Clearing Systems as follows:

 

11.4.1the Initial Term Sheet New Notes to the Initial Participating Scheme Creditors (or their Designated Recipients, if any) in the aggregate principal amount of the Term Sheet New Notes to which they are entitled, as calculated in accordance with the formula set out in Clause 11.2 above; and

 

11.4.2the Surplus Term Sheet New Notes to the Scheme Consideration Trustee to be held on trust for the Participating Scheme Creditors during the Holding Period in accordance with the terms of the Distribution Agreement.

 

11.5On the Initial Distribution Date, the portion of the Term Sheet New Notes which do not form Scheme Consideration will be allocated to the relevant accounts of the Senior Lenders in the Clearing Systems in accordance with the terms of the Senior Secured Facilities Restructuring Documents.

 

11.6During the Holding Period, the Scheme Consideration Trustee shall make Quarterly Distributions of the Surplus Term Sheet New Notes (including any interest paid to the Scheme Consideration Trustee by Energy Resources in respect thereof) to those Participating Scheme Creditors (or their Designated Recipients, if any) who are not Initial Participating Scheme Creditors or those Participating Scheme

 

48 

 

Creditors who have already received their entitlement to the Surplus Term Sheet New Notes on a prior Quarterly Distribution Date, if applicable, in the aggregate principal amount of the Surplus Term Sheet New Notes to which they are entitled, as calculated in accordance with the formula set out in Clause 11.2 above and pursuant to the terms of the Distribution Agreement.

 

11.7On the Final Distribution Date, the Scheme Consideration Trustee shall distribute the Surplus Term Sheet New Notes (including any interest paid to the Scheme Consideration Trustee by Energy Resources in respect thereof) as follows:

 

11.7.1first, by way of the final Quarterly Distribution, to those Participating Scheme Creditors or their Designated Recipients, if any, who are not Initial Participating Scheme Creditors or those Participating Scheme Creditors who have already received their entitlement to the Surplus Term Sheet New Notes on a prior Quarterly Distribution Date, in the aggregate principal amount of the Surplus Term Sheet New Notes to which they are entitled, as calculated in accordance with Clause 11.2 above and pursuant to the terms of the Distribution Agreement; and

 

11.7.2second, in the event that there is any Remaining Surplus Scheme Consideration, the Scheme Consideration Trustee shall use its reasonable endeavours to sell the Remaining Surplus Scheme Consideration as soon as reasonably practicable after the Final Distribution Date and (after the deduction of reasonable costs and expenses) transfer the net cash proceeds of sale to any charity which the Company may select in its sole discretion.

 

11.8The holders of the New Notes shall have the benefit of the New Shared Security.

 

11.9No Participating Scheme Creditor shall be entitled to receive the Term Sheet New Notes under more than one Scheme. Without prejudice to the generality of Clause 27, the performance by the Company of its obligations under this Clause 11 shall operate to discharge any corresponding obligations of the Company under the Hong Kong Scheme.

 

11.10The obligations of Energy Resources to issue and allot the Term Sheet New Notes to each Participating Scheme Creditor entitled to receive them under this Cayman Scheme shall be satisfied by Energy Resources depositing the New Notes (including, for the avoidance of doubt, the Term Sheet New Notes) in global

 

49 

 

registered form with the New Notes Depository or its nominee for the accounts of the Clearing Systems.
